C
Procedure
Posted
Limitation of Actions
In case of limitation of time, provide for the contingency
of an abatement of the suit, in nonsuch
a verdict for want of evidence's appearing &c Or on
Appeal.
Provide also for night of Attorney's &C. In such
case let the Action be commenced notwithstanding, & Act
if any inconvenience arise to the Deft let the Plfff's Attorney
&c be answerable to the Deft for it.
Title Of Pardon by Lapse of time
Posted</lb/>Expediting [Interest]
or Defendants
interest
Wherever any delay has been occasioned by
the application of the Deft let the time be noted
and if the Deft prevail and get compensation
money be awarded him let the interest upon such
compensation money be allowed him for that home.
Let such interest be of course one third more than
the ordinary highest rate of ordinary interest allowed of in this
Country. Let this be called expediting interest. But
let the Judge may upon particular grounds reduce it as low
as to ordinary legal interest
Penal interest
for d
where the delay has been affected, let the interest
be of course double the common legal interest. Let this be called
Penal interest. But the Judge may upon special
grounds reduce it so low as down to ordinary
legal interest.
Compound interest
[In case of affected delay let the delayer] Where penal interest is given let the party
be subjected also to compound interest: then pre interest
being added to the principal every quarter.
<p.Interest upon an
Appeal
Upon an Appeal let penal interest be given
of course; form the time of the Judgment unless the Judge certify that there was probable
cause for the Appeal.
Interest upon Costs
of the Appeal
Let Interest also be given upon the costs of the Appeal:
computing it as if they had all been incurred on the day
